From a disc of radius `R` and mass `M`, a circular hole of diameter `R`, whose rim passes through the centre is cut. What is the moment of inertia of remaining part of the disc about a perependicular axis, passing through the centre ?

A

`13 MR^(2)//32`

B

`11 MR^(2)//32`

C

`9 MR^(2)//32`

D

`15 MR^(2)//32`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
a
